LONDON (Dunya News) - A massive protest was held in front of the Indian Embassy in London to mark Youm-e-Istehsal Kashmir here on Wednesday.
A large number of protesters with Kashmiri and Pakistani flags participated in the protest. Elderly people, women, children, and people from different walks of life also participated in the demonstration in large numbers.
The protesters raised slogans against the Indian occupation and expressed solidarity with the Kashmiris. The participants raised slogans such as "Kashmir will become Pakistan" and "Down with Indian aggression" and expressed their determination to continue the struggle until independence.
The protesters said that on August 5, 2019 India ended the status of occupied Jammu and Kashmir, adding Indian embassy is involved in anti-Pakistan and anti-Kashmir activities, and Kashmiris and Pakistanis are one soul and two flesh.
People from occupied Kashmir also participated in the protest in full force. The protesters demanded that the international community take notice of the human rights violations in occupied Kashmir, and said that support for the right of the Kashmiri people to self-determination would continue.
